Katari Hotel at Plaza De Armas – Arequipa, Peru

The terrace garden at Hotel Katari allows you to relax and appreciate the entire city of Arequipa, Peru including a landmark front view of the main cathedral with the volcanic background.

Through its optimal location, landmark terrace, highly personalized service, luxurious historical interior design, and most exclusive facilities and services, Hotel Katari at Plaza de Armas will ensure you will have an unparalleled stay in the White City.

Katari is a term commonly associated in Peru with the respect of the indigenous Andean cultures. Hotel Katari at Plaza de Armas, is an invitation to experience the essence of Arequipa, regarding both its colonial influence and its interesting pre-colonial history while providing an incomparable view of its most impressive geography, all the elements for which UNESCO protects the city center as a World Heritage Site.

Superior Rooms

These rooms mix traditional Arequipan colonial furniture with other interior design elements that evoke Arequipa’s Pre-Colombian past.

Deluxe Rooms

These rooms contain interior design elements which we get from other Puquina-speaking ethnic groups that settled on the eastern side of the Chili river, such as the Socabayas, Yarabayas, and Chiribayas.
